Senior Instrumentation & Controls Embedded Software Engineer (Remote Eligible, U.S.)

Remote, USA Full-time Posted 2026-06-16

Job Description

Summary The I&C (Instrumentation & Controls) Embedded Software Engineer works within the I&C Engineering team of the GE Vernova Hitachi (GVH) Engineering organization. The I&C team is responsible for designing and implementing I&C electronic hardware and software for I&C systems for Nuclear Power Plants. The I&C software team has strong interfaces with electronic hardware design and plant system operations. This role requires technical problem solving, strong software skills and effective communication/collaboration with other teams within the GVH business functions.

Job Description

Essential Responsibilities: The I&C Software Engineer is responsible for the delivery of high-quality engineering software. Work scope typically includes the following essential responsibilities:

  • Develop creative solutions and reduce complexity to create accurate and effective solutions for complex engineering problems.
  • Typical embedded software activities will include preparing design specifications, developing software, performing module testing, and integration testing of the design. Performing Code Reviews and verifications of Design Specifications and Reports.
  • Engage customers to define scope, review results, and discuss technical risks.
  • Perform integration testing of software solutions using Hardware-in-the-Loop (HIL) simulation and full end to end operational testing.
  • Work with the technical leader to establish an effective work plan, including time estimates, schedule estimates, requirements and work processes.
  • Apply engineering fundamentals and 1st order engineering principles to establish and/or confirm expected performance.
  • Provide clear and complete analysis documentation in accordance with GEH engineering procedures.
  • Manage time effectively to provide quality deliverables within the expected project timeline.
  • Communicate effectively to leadership the status of work activities.
  • Provide leadership and mentoring to junior staff.
  • Effectively manage multiple priorities.

Basic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's Degree in electrical, computer or software engineering from an accredited college or university.
  • Minimum of 10 years of experience in embedded software development, including knowledge of common computer languages and software development tools (GitLab, Jira, LDRA, Arm Development Studio, Visual Studio, GDB, etc.).
  • Minimum of 7 years of advanced knowledge of the C programming languages.
  • Minimum of 10 years of experience with coding conventions, code review, unit testing and integration testing of software.
